Understand group therapy benefits
Group addiction therapy offers a supportive environment where you can connect with peers who share similar experiences. By participating in structured group sessions, you gain:
- Emotional support from individuals facing comparable challenges
- Opportunities to practice interpersonal skills in a safe setting
- Accountability that can strengthen your commitment to recovery
Evidence shows that group counseling enhances relapse prevention by fostering peer encouragement and collective problem solving. You’ll learn coping strategies, stress management techniques, and insights into triggers, all while feeling less isolated on your journey.
Navigate Medicaid eligibility
Coverage under New Jersey Medicaid
New Jersey’s Medicaid program, known as NJ FamilyCare, provides outpatient substance use counseling and group therapy services to eligible adults and young adults. Covered services typically include:
- Group counseling sessions
- Relapse prevention education
- Medication management support
Income and eligibility criteria
To qualify for NJ FamilyCare, you must meet income thresholds and residency requirements. Eligibility categories often include:
- Adults with incomes up to 138% of the federal poverty level
- Individuals with disabilities or serious mental illness
- Pregnant women and young adults under age 26

Prepare for sessions
What to expect
During your first group session, you’ll:
- Meet your facilitator and fellow participants
- Review confidentiality guidelines
- Discuss session structure and goals
Subsequent meetings may include check-ins, skill-building exercises, and open discussion.
Tips for engagement
To make the most of group therapy:
- Attend consistently to build trust
- Share honestly about your experiences
- Practice active listening with peers
- Set personal goals before each session
Preparation helps you engage fully and reinforces your commitment.
Manage costs and approvals
Prior authorization process
Some Medicaid plans require prior approval for intensive outpatient or longer-term group programs. To streamline this:
- Obtain a referral from your primary care provider
- Submit necessary forms through your Medicaid portal
- Work with C-Line Outreach’s admissions team to coordinate authorizations
Out-of-pocket expenses
Medically necessary group counseling is generally covered without copayments under NJ FamilyCare. However, you may encounter:
- Minimal fees for optional services
- Charges for missed appointments without advance notice
Always verify coverage details with your case manager to avoid surprises.
